Tips for Finding Occupational Therapist Jobs at BAYADA Home Health Care

Verify Your OT Licensure Before Applying

Each state BAYADA operates in requires an active OT license. Start the licensure endorsement process early, delays here stall your start date and can complicate H-1B petition timing, since your employment cannot begin before license approval.

Target BAYADA's Home Health Divisions Strategically

BAYADA fills OT roles across pediatric, adult, and hospice service lines. Identify which division matches your clinical specialty and apply directly to those postings. Home health OT roles often have faster hiring cycles than hospital settings, which helps compress your sponsorship timeline.

Confirm Credential Evaluation Covers Home Health Requirements

If your OT degree is from outside the U.S., get a course-by-course credential evaluation from a NACES-approved agency. USCIS requires this for specialty occupation classification, and home health employers like BAYADA will ask for it during onboarding.

Ask Recruiters About LCA Filing Timelines Upfront

BAYADA's HR process includes a Labor Condition Application filed with DOL before any H-1B petition can move forward. Ask your recruiter at the offer stage which regional office handles LCA filings and what their typical turnaround looks like, so you can plan around the 90-day cap-subject filing window.

Understand How TN Status Works for OT Roles

Canadian and Mexican OTs can enter on TN status, which BAYADA can support at the port of entry without a petition. TN for OTs requires proof of a qualifying degree and a job offer letter specifying the OT classification. This is faster than H-1B and has no annual cap.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does BAYADA Home Health Care sponsor H-1B visas for Occupational Therapists?

Yes, BAYADA Home Health Care has sponsored H-1B visas for Occupational Therapist roles. OT positions generally qualify as specialty occupations under USCIS criteria because they require a bachelor's or master's degree in occupational therapy. Sponsorship availability can vary by location and service line, so confirm directly with the recruiting team during the offer stage.

Which visa types does BAYADA Home Health Care commonly use for Occupational Therapist hires?

BAYADA sponsors H-1B visas for OTs in specialty occupation roles and supports F-1 OPT and CPT for students completing clinical rotations or early-career placements. Canadian and Mexican OTs may use TN status, which does not require a petition and has no annual cap. The right visa type depends on your nationality, degree, and whether you're already in the U.S.

What qualifications does BAYADA Home Health Care expect from Occupational Therapist candidates?

BAYADA typically requires a master's degree in occupational therapy, a current state license in the state where you'll practice, and NBCOT certification. For home health roles, prior clinical experience with adult or pediatric populations is common. International candidates should have a course-by-course credential evaluation from a NACES-approved agency ready before the offer stage.

How long does the visa sponsorship process take for an OT role at BAYADA?

For H-1B sponsorship, the process typically spans several months from offer letter to work authorization. Your employer must file a Labor Condition Application with DOL before USCIS can process the petition. Cap-subject H-1B filings are limited to an April 1 start date at the earliest. TN status for Canadian citizens can be obtained at the border on the day of travel, making it significantly faster.
